Senators Press RFK Jr on Vaccine Stance and CDC Overhaul

Robert F. Kennedy Jr faced intense scrutiny from lawmakers on Thursday as they grilled him about his leadership and vaccine policies during a heated hearing. He stood firm, defending his sweeping changes in US health agencies, particularly the controversial removal of experts from the CDC advisory panel.

 

Democrats accused Kennedy of lying and blocking vaccine access, while Republicans offered a mixed response, praising some initiatives but questioning the execution. The hearing followed a recent tumultuous decision to dismiss 600 CDC employees and the agency's head, sparking alarm among health professionals.

 

In June, Kennedy's dramatic overhaul of the independent vaccine advisory panel created a stir, with experts warning about the qualifications of the new appointees, some of whom oppose vaccines. Tensions soared during the committee session as Kennedy responded sharply to criticism about limiting Covid-19 vaccine access, an issue that continues to divide opinions.

 

Senators from both parties questioned Kennedy's understanding of vaccine efficacy data, although he insisted the vaccines saved "quite a few" lives. Despite this, he cited "data chaos" from the previous administration as a hindrance. As discussions strained, Senator Cassidy, a doctor by profession, pushed Kennedy on Covid-19 booster availability, reported the BBC.

 

This political drama unfolds against a backdrop of public concern over vaccine misinformation, with many health officials accusing Kennedy of undermining trust in public health measures. The US grapples with its worst measles outbreak in decades, further fuelling the debate on the necessity and safety of vaccines under Kennedy's tenure.

The International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C) is a branch of the WHO. It listed alcohol as a Class 1 carcinogen in 1988, linking cancers of the mouth, pharynx, larynx, esophagus, liver, colorectum and female breast.

Members of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s family are calling for him to step down as US health secretary following a contentious congressional hearing, during which he faced serious questioning about his tumultuous leadership of federal health agencies.

 

Kennedy’s sister, Kerry Kennedy, and his nephew, Joseph P. Kennedy III, issued scathing statements on Friday, a day after Kennedy had to defend his recent efforts to pull back Covid-19 vaccine recommendations and fire high-level officials at the Centres for Disease Control at a three-hour Senate hearing.

 

“Robert F. Kennedy Jr. is a threat to the health and wellbeing of every American,” Joseph P. Kennedy III said in a post on X. The former congressman added: “None of us will be spared the pain he is inflicting.”

Appointment by RFK Jr.


David Geier was recently appointed by Health and Human Services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r. to lead a federal study on the causes of autism.


- **Not a licensed doctor**: Geier has never held a medical license and was previously charged in Maryland for practicing medicine without one.


- **Lupron treatments**: Alongside his father, Dr. Mark Geier, he promoted the use of Lupron—a hormone suppressant typically used to treat prostate cancer and delay puberty—as a treatment for autism. Their theory linked mercury from vaccines and testosterone to autism symptoms, claiming Lupron could mitigate these effects.


- **Scientific rejection**: Their studies were widely discredited and retracted. The medical community condemned the treatments as unethical and unsupported by evidence.


- **Patent attempt**: The Geiers even filed a patent for using Lupron to treat autism, despite lacking clinical validation.
